Purpose Statement:
The job of the high school principal is to plan, coordinate and direct the academic and administrative activities of a Hawkins County School System high school.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ities:
The duties of the high school principal may include, but are not limited to, the following:
- Confer with parents and staff to discuss educational activities, policies, and student behavioral or learning problems.
- Observe teaching methods and examine learning materials to evaluate and standardize curricula and teaching techniques, and to determine areas where improvement is needed.
- Collaborate with teachers to develop and maintain curriculum standards, develop mission statements, and set performance goals and objectives.
- Recruit, hire, train, and evaluate primary and supplemental staff.
- Plan and lead professional development activities for teachers, administrators, and support staff.
- Determine allocations of funds for staff, supplies, materials, and equipment, and authorize purchases
- Prepare and submit budget requests and recommendations, or grant proposals to solicit program funding.
- Determine the scope of educational program offerings, and prepare drafts of course schedules and descriptions to estimate staffing and facility requirements.
- Review and approve new programs, or recommend modifications to existing programs, submitting program proposals for school board approval as necessary.
- Recommend personnel actions related to programs and services.
- Participate in special education-related activities such as attending meetings and providing support to special educators within the school
- Develop partnerships with businesses, communities, and other organizations to help meet identified educational needs and to provide school-to-work programs.
- Collect and analyze survey data, regulatory information, and data on demographic and employment trends to forecast enrollment patterns and curriculum change needs.
- Coordinate and direct extracurricular activities and programs such as after-school events and athletic contests
- Implement safety procedures within the school to include conducting safety drills
- Perform other duties as assigned by the Director of Hawkins County Schools
